What is advertising sales?

Advertising sales involve selling advertising space or time to businesses and organizations looking to promote their products or services. Professionals in this field work with clients to understand their marketing needs, develop advertising solutions, and negotiate contracts. They may sell advertising through various media, such as television, radio, print publications, digital platforms, or outdoor billboards. Success in advertising sales requires strong communication, negotiation, and relationship-building skills, as well as an understanding of marketing trends and media options.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an advertising sales professional?

To thrive as an Advertising Sales professional, you need strong sales acumen, negotiation skills, and a deep understanding of advertising strategies, typically supported by a degree in marketing, business, or communications. Familiarity with customer relationship management (CRM) software, digital advertising platforms, and analytics tools is often required. Outstanding interpersonal skills, resilience, and persuasive communication set top performers apart in this field. These skills are essential for building client relationships, closing deals, and driving revenue in a fast-paced, target-driven environment.

What are some common challenges faced by professionals in advertising sales, and how can they be addressed?

Professionals in Advertising Sales often encounter challenges such as meeting aggressive sales targets, managing client expectations, and staying current with rapidly changing digital advertising trends. To address these, successful salespeople focus on building strong client relationships, keeping up-to-date with industry developments, and leveraging data-driven insights to tailor their pitches. Collaboration with creative, marketing, and account management teams is also crucial to deliver effective campaigns and ensure client satisfaction.

What is the difference between Advertising Sales vs Advertising Account Executive?

AspectAdvertising SalesAdvertising Account Executive
Primary RoleFocuses on selling advertising space or time to clientsManages client accounts and coordinates advertising campaigns
Required SkillsSales techniques, negotiation, industry knowledgeClient communication, campaign management, creativity
Work EnvironmentSales offices, media companies, advertising agenciesAdvertising agencies, media outlets, client sites
Common CertificationsSales certifications, industry-specific trainingMarketing or advertising certifications, portfolio

Advertising Sales primarily involves selling advertising space or airtime, focusing on generating revenue through client acquisition. Advertising Account Executives manage client relationships and oversee campaign execution. While both roles require industry knowledge and communication skills, Advertising Sales emphasizes sales techniques, whereas Advertising Account Executives focus on client management and campaign coordination.
